Content available remote Value stream mapping of a unique complex product manufacturing process
EN
Value stream mapping is a method used for wastes’ identification in manufacturing systems as well as in other processes realized in the companies. The method is well known and applied in different areas and industries. However, as each process is different, every time when the method is used, some unexpected problems in its implementation can appear or the method has to be applied in a specific way. In this paper, the value stream mapping method is applied in order to analyse a manufacturing system in which unique complex products are manufactured. The paper discusses important issues which have to be taken into consideration while the method is applied in the circumstances similar to these presented in the analysed case study. In the work, on the basis of the collected data, the current state of a value stream map was developed. Then, the problems existing in the manufacturing system were identified and analysed. Finally, on the basis of the suggested solutions for the problems, the future state of a value stream map was proposed. The paper emphasizes the aspects important in the value stream mapping of a unique complex product manufacturing process.

Logistics activities play in important role in supporting the production process for a wide range of products in many industries, such as the automotive or electrical engineering industries. In the automotive industry, they are present throughout the entire production cycle. To perform these activities, various technologies as well as economic aspects must be considered and employed. This contribution describes the technology of interior parts manufacturing for the automotive industry and specifies costs connected to the preparation and setting of machines and devices in individual workplaces as well as the cost items linked with their production and subsequent logistic activities.

Lean is one of the systematic approach to achieve higher value for organizations through eliminate non-value-added activities. It is an integrated set of tools, techniques, and principles designed to optimize cost, quality and delivery while improving safety. In Vietnam, industry waste management and treatment has become serious issue. The aim of this research is to present the effective of Lean application for industrial wastes collecting and delivery improvement. Through a case study, this paper showed the way of Lean tools and principles applied for wastes management and treatment such as Value Stream Mapping, Pull system, Visual Control, and Andon to get benefit on both economic and environment. In addition, the results introduced a good experience for enterprises in Vietnam and other countries have similar conditions to Vietnam in cost saving and sustainable development in waste management.

Content available Production line with embedded Lean approach
EN
The paper describes the course of the process of starting up a new assembly line with embedded Lean Management approach in one of production companies in Wroclaw. There were documented the processes of implementing and maintaining the manufacturing and logistics solutions as well as organizational and behavioral solutions that provide the basis for the new system. Then the results of the improvements to be implemented were analyzed in relation to the area functioning in accordance with the old system within the same production hall. The issue of disturbances in the system approach in connection with the introduction of changes was discussed only for a single process.
